What are the opposite words for hand picks?
The phrase "hand picks" refers to selecting or choosing something carefully or with great attention to detail. Its antonyms would be words or phrases that suggest a lack of care or thoughtfulness in the selection process. Words like "randomly," "haphazardly," and "carelessly" can all serve as antonyms for hand picks. For example, if someone were to say, "I just randomly picked a book off the shelf," that would be the opposite of hand picking a book with care and consideration. Similarly, the phrase "thoughtlessly selected" could also serve as an antonym for hand picks, suggesting that the selection process was not given adequate thought or attention.
